Дмитрий Падучих <[email protected]> writes: > > To> После вычесления этих выражений по C-x C-e, команды переназначаются > To> как им положено, но при загрузки emacs они не производят нужного > To> эфекта и вычислять их приходится в ручную. Речь идет о emacspeak из > To> речевого архива, при запуске emacspeak новых линеек таких трабл нет. > > Emacspeak переопределяет некоторые из этих клавиш после загрузки .emacs. > Попробуйте добавить в .emacs: > > (remove-hook 'after-init-hook 'emacspeak-keymap-refresh)
Спасибо, после добавления выражения переназначения стали загружатся. )> > > Emacspeak не из архива делает то же самое. Трудно сказать, почему с > ним этой проблемы нет. Возможно, дело в том, что скрипт emacspeak не > из архива запускает Emacs с ключом -q, и в результате функции Да, действительно. Не пробывал собирать emacspeak28, но последующии версии его запустить строкой из скрипта, как это делалось с emacspeak27 никак не удавалось export EMACSPEAK=/путь/emacspeak/lisp/emacspeak-setup. это приводило к последствиям примерно такого плана как упоминал в в листе один из участников . запустить удалось их лишь приведя эту строку в состояние: exec emacs -q -l нy/путь/emacspeak-30.0/lisp/emacspeak-setup.el $INITSTR $CL_ALL export EMACSPEAK И еще добавив пару строк обеспечивающих инициализацию из ~/. Возможно этого можно было добится и каким другим более изящным заклинаньем, у меня нашлось только это. > To> Еще в emacspeak не работает команда > To> C-e | (emacspeak-speak-line-set-column-filter FILTER) > To> причем как в архивном emacspeak, так и в его более старших версиях > To> установленых после разварачивания архива. Хотя по нажатию C-h k C-e > To> | emacs команду знает и выдает по ней документацию. > > Я думаю, что раз C-h k показывает документацию на эту команду, то она > выполняется. Но в ней происходит какая-то ошибка, или же вы что-то не > так вводите. C-e |: load: Cannot open load file: /home/login/.emacspeak/.filters > > To> Каким образом определять местонахождения курсора или объектов; > > Уточните, пожалуйста. Например каким образом получить координаты для задания фильтра по C-e | для таблиц, frеймов в том же w3m-el и других ситуациях требующих задания координат. Хотя тут подумал что возможно в emacspeak есть и другие команды кроме C-e m и C-e M при помощи которых можно получать всевозможную информацию относительно того места в котором находишся?? > > > To> можно ли средствами emacspeak организовать проверку орфографии; > > Да, можно. В Emacs для этого есть пакеты ispell.el и flyspell.el. В > Emacspeak предусмотрено озвучивание для этих пакетов. Чтобы ими > воспользоваться, нужно установить ispell и необходимые словари. . Со временем разберусь и с этим вопросом . Пока на нем небуду задерживать внимание, так как разбирательство могло бы затянуть ответ в обсуждении на добрую неделю.> большое спасибо за ответы. > To> какие в сабже есть системы автоматических оповещений и каким образом > To> их можно применять. > > Ммм? Есть буфера, в некоторых из буферов могут протекать различные процесы, процесы зачастую сигнализируют о результатах своей деятельности какой либо индикацией либо посылая сообщения пользователю ожидая его реакции. Каким образом можно обустраивать emacspeak так, что бы он автоматически подмечал и оповещал о зафиксированных изменениях в указаных ему буферах. -- Blinux-rus mailing list [email protected] http://www.a11ywiki.org/cgi-bin/mailman/listinfo/blinux-rus
